Ammonia
A colorless gas with a pungent smell, composed of nitrogen and hydrogen (NH3), used widely as a fertiliser and industrial feedstock.
Propanoic Acid
A short-chain fatty acid with the formula C2H5COOH, known for its unpleasant odor similar to body sweat.
Methyl Propanoate
An ester formed from methanol and propanoic acid, often used as a solvent or in the synthesis of other compounds.
